CALIBRATE_PROBE_Z_OFFSET macro calculates an incorrect Z-offset. #354

The z-offset value generated by the CALIBRATE_PROBE_Z_OFFSET macro is consistently too low (i.e. the nozzle is too high) 100% of the time. I always ensure the nozzle has adequate friction against the paper during the calibration, and to correctly save and apply the offset, only for the next print to begin above the print surface without fail. The generated value appears to be off by a consistent amount (approx. 0.365mm) from my observations. I was able to manually adjust and save the z-offset without issue, however I would really like to avoid the needing to do that every time I adjust the bed screws.

I am using a Neptune 4 Plus with the latest version of OpenNept4ne
